A High Court of the Federal Capital Territory in Abuja has granted bail of ten million naira each to Mike Ozekhome SAN and his co-defendant, Ponfa Useni, following their arraignment on a 12-count criminal charge filed by the Office of the Attorney General of the Federation.
The defendants pleaded not guilty to allegations including forgery of an international passport and an irrevocable power of attorney used to claim ownership of a London property said to have been unlawfully procured by the late Jeremiah Useni.
Counsel to the Attorney General, Rotimi Oyedepo SAN, did not oppose bail when applications were made by defence lawyers Tayo Oyetibo SAN and F. R. Onoja SAN

In her ruling on Friday, Justice Chizoba Oji ordered each defendant to provide one surety with property in the Federal Capital Territory and to deposit their international passports with the court, directing them to meet the conditions by Monday or face remand in prison.
